Kollimalai Nature Itinerary

Exploring the Natural Beauty of Kollimalai

Thursday, September 28, 2023

8:00 AM: Departure

Start your day early and depart from your location towards Kollimalai, a picturesque hill station nestled in the Eastern Ghats of Tamil Nadu, India.

10:00 AM: Kollimalai Hills

Arrive at Kollimalai Hills, a haven for nature enthusiasts. These hills are known for their scenic beauty, lush green forests, and breathtaking viewpoints. Spend some time hiking along the trails, enjoying the fresh air, and capturing the panoramic views of the surrounding landscape. Cost: Free.

12:00 PM: Agaya Gangai Waterfalls

Head towards Agaya Gangai Waterfalls, a mesmerizing waterfall nestled amidst dense forests. Take a refreshing dip in the cool waters or simply relax while enjoying the serene surroundings. Pack a picnic lunch to enjoy amidst nature. Cost: Free.

2:00 PM: Solar Observatory

Visit the Kollimalai Solar Observatory, known for its astronomical research and stargazing opportunities. Explore the exhibits, learn about the solar system, and witness sunspots and solar flares through the observatory's telescopes. Cost: Free.

4:00 PM: Arappaleeswarar Temple

End the day with a visit to Arappaleeswarar Temple, an ancient Hindu temple dedicated to Lord Shiva. Admire the intricate architectural details, participate in the evening prayers, and soak in the spiritual ambiance of the temple. Cost: Free.

6:00 PM: Local Cuisine Experience

Indulge in the local cuisine of Kollimalai by trying traditional Tamil dishes at a nearby restaurant. Savor the flavors of authentic South Indian delicacies like dosa, idli, and sambar. Cost: Estimated INR 500 per person.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For those seeking off the beaten path attractions and places loved by locals in Kollimalai, consider visiting the Secret Falls. This hidden gem offers a secluded waterfall experience with fewer crowds. It requires a bit of hiking to reach, but the tranquility and natural beauty make it worth the effort. Another local favorite is the Periya Malai, a lesser-known hill in Kollimalai, offering picturesque views and serene surroundings. Take a leisurely hike to the top and witness the stunning sunset over the hills.
